Output f597bbd96e1a618ac70484171873defea838d0731f2a0a7c8e594de21569831b:23

value
59315208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51425f82b1147a27645eb300cc2eea8b20e50388 OP_EQUAL
address
MFJpUejjXhN1YsosirGF9qVJdCcEpkjDu7
transaction
f597bbd96e1a618ac70484171873defea838d0731f2a0a7c8e594de21569831b
spent
true